Industry Background and the OEM/ODM Challenge in Energy Storage

The global energy transition is accelerating, yet infrastructure in many regions has not kept pace. In markets such as Southeast Asia and Iraq, imperfect power infrastructure and large grid fluctuations leave households and enterprises facing low power quality, high energy costs, and unreliable off-grid supply. Industry pain points converge around four themes: energy stability challenges caused by sudden power outages that interrupt business operations and risk data loss; low energy utilization stemming from insufficient photovoltaic self-consumption rates, which raises electricity costs; poor environmental adaptability of power equipment in coastal, high-temperature, and high-dust conditions, leading to elevated failure rates; and remote power supply difficulties, where off-grid areas remain dependent on diesel generators with high operating costs and frequent maintenance.

Against this backdrop, energy storage brands increasingly need manufacturing partners capable of delivering solar inverter ODM services that go beyond hardware assembly—covering branding, quality inspection, and technical documentation. Deep Insights: Technology and Market Trends Shaping Solar Inverter Manufacturing

Product development within SOROTEC's portfolio illustrates broader technology trends relevant to ODM buyers. Protection-level engineering has become a differentiator, with an IP66 series suited to deserts, coastal areas, and plateaus, an IP54 series built for commercial-and-industrial and high-end residential scenarios supporting 120A charging current, and a cost-effective IP21 series for basic residential installations. Seamless switching performance—down to 10ms—addresses the need for uninterrupted operation of sensitive equipment during grid failure, while dual MPPT designs and wide MPPT voltage ranges (such as 60–450VDC) improve generation yield across varied panel orientations.

Market trends point toward multi-energy compatibility and flexible economics: several inverter lines support diesel generator input for charging, peak-valley arbitrage strategies that automatically schedule charging and discharging based on electricity prices, and parallel expansion—up to six units in some series—to scale capacity from residential to small industrial and commercial use. Compliance requirements are also intensifying as products move across more than 100 countries, making certifications such as CE, UL, FCC, and CAPE a practical necessity rather than a differentiator alone. On the risk side, environmental durability remains a persistent concern; SOROTEC's stated operating temperature ranges—for example, -30°C to 60°C verification and -25°C to 60°C for specific inverter models—reflect the industry's need to validate performance under extreme conditions before deployment. Standardization through recognized quality and intellectual property management systems continues to serve as the mechanism by which OEM/ODM buyers can verify manufacturing consistency at scale.
